Why does Fairview Church call Sunday morning a “worship gathering” rather than a “worship service”?
Pastors Tyler, Devin, and Drew open Season 6 by exploring how our language shapes our understanding of the church and its worship. They discuss worship as more than music, the biblical significance of God gathering His people, and the difference between participating in worship and approaching Sunday as a consumer.
The conversation also considers how believers can prepare throughout the week, why Fairview’s gatherings include Scripture, prayer, preaching, singing, the ordinances, creeds, and giving, and what should happen when God’s people genuinely worship together.
Ultimately, the gathering is not merely something we attend or receive from. It is the church assembling to honor God, encourage one another, be formed into the likeness of Christ, and then scatter to live faithfully on mission.
